PROSPBUTI SIGRAPHICS/COLINCIL AGENDA AEMBENCENEERING2002MATEPUTILI YPROPOSED ONGOR EASEMENT MB DATE: June 6, 2003 SUBJECT: City Council Meeting — June 12, 2003 ITEM: *10.F.3. Consider a resolution authorizing the Mayor to execute an Easement and Right -of -Way to Oncor Electric Delivery Company in connection with the Water Treatment Plant Expansion, Phase V. Resource: Tom Word, Chief of Public Works Operations Tom Clark, Director of Utilities History: As part of the Phase V - Water Treatment Plant Expansion, an additional high service pump will be added to meet the City's peak water demands. The addition of this pump requires the addition of a new 1500 kvA transformer. This easement is required by Oncor to install the new transformer, a new power pole and the primary power line to serve the transformer. Funding: Cost: N/A Source of funds: N/A Outside Resources: Oncor Electric Delivery Company Impact/Benefit: Required to complete the Phase V, Water Treatment Plant Expansion.
